I’m trying to make a custom infowindow. Version = 2.
I have added my DIV to the map as follows –
$(“#infoWindowClass”).appendTo(map.getPane(G_MAP_MARKER_MOUSE_TARGET_PANE));
The infoWindowClass is –
#infoWindowClass
{
position:absolute;
padding:10px;
height: 155px;
width: 225px;
background-color: #E7F8CD;
color: #3F3F3F;
border:0.5px solid #8D8D8D;
font-size:80%;
}
Per documentation, this is above all other DIV layers.
This DIV has two input fields, however I can’t click on any of them.
I manually added the z-index to 990 for this DIV but the input fields are still not clickable.
Any pointers ?
Found the solution, instead of assigning my layer to a specific google-map layer, I left it out.
I mean, I commented it this –
And viola ! It worked 😎
